Mistakes To Avoid While Choosing Football Cleats

0

Choosing the wrong sports accessories can prove to be quite detrimental for you as it not only affects the quality of your game but can also cause physical injuries to you in worst cases. This rule applies to soccer cleats as well. You have done a lot of hard work to be playing soccer at your level; you have chosen your uniform and soccer gear with all the passion. So isn’t it natural that you should pay the same level of attention while choosing your soccer cleats as well? The reason why we are stressing upon the need to choose the right shoes is that a small mistake here can lead to severe consequences like blisters, redness, soreness, swelling or any other problem in your toes, causing you to trip and fall on the ground which may lead to other injuries as well. Some of the common mistakes that people commit while choosing their cleats are mentioned here. Read them and be informed so that you don’t repeat them in your life.

1. Too much of attention to cost

Never allow money to dominate your decision of buying soccer cleats. Yes, you might be thrilled to have a pair of cheap football boots for yourself; however, you should remember that the quality of your shoes is directly proportional to its cost. If you settle for low-priced shoes, you should bear the brunt of sub-standard quality. For example, the shoes may not fit your properly or may cause you discomfort when worn for long hours or may cause you to lose your balance and fall flat on the ground. Synthetic shoes are available a price that is at least 50% lower than the premium leather shoes; however, they are very tight and don’t have ventilation at all. As a result, your toes feel suffocated and are not able to breathe, causing swelling and redness.

2. Impulsive purchase or purchase based on recommendations

You should never purchase a particular brand of soccer cleats because your friend recommended the same. What suits for one person may not suit for another. Also, shoes that suit one playing position don’t suit another. Therefore, you need to understand your expertise, your position, the frequency of playing and the ground in which you would be playing, thoroughly. This clarity will help you choose shoes that are compatible with your playing conditions.

3. Not paying focus to durability

Soccer cleats don’t look cheap. Therefore, when you make the initial investment in them, you should buy shoes that have a long durability factor. Durability is one of the most important yet one of the most underrated factors when it comes to buying soccer cleats. Though the investment is quite huge, you should buy shoes that are good to be used for at least a couple of years. When you invest in low-quality shoes, they may be good for a couple of months and then start wearing out at places, leading to huge maintenance expenses for you.
